What is Condensation?
Condensation happens when water vapor in the air cools and becomes liquid water. This process is affected by temperature and humidity levels in the environment. When warm air, which can hold more moisture, enters into contact with a cooler surface area (like a window glass), it cools off. If the air's temperature level drops listed below its humidity, the moisture condenses on the glass, forming beads of water.

Numerous factors add to condensation forming on windows. The main causes consist of:
High Indoor Humidity: Cooking, bathing, drying clothes, and even breathing contribute to indoor humidity levels. Excessive moisture in small, improperly aerated spaces is a prime condition for condensation.
Temperature level Difference: When warm air inside a space satisfies the cold surface area of a window, condensation can happen. This is particularly obvious during winter season months when indoor temperature levels may be significantly warmer than outside temperature levels.
Air Tightness: Modern homes are frequently constructed with a focus on energy performance, resulting in tight building. While this avoids heat loss, it likewise restricts air flow and can cause moisture to develop inside.
Insulating Properties of Windows: Older single-pane windows are especially vulnerable to condensation due to the fact that they do not have the insulating properties of modern double or triple-glazed windows. This can make them cold adequate to promote condensation during cooler months.

While condensation is a natural procedure, it can have detrimental impacts if not handled effectively. A few of these impacts consist of:
Mold Growth: Persistent moisture can cause mold, which can adversely impact health and necessitate costly removal.Damage to Window Frames: Wood window frames can warp or rot due to prolonged direct exposure to moisture.Peeling Paint and Wallpaper: Excess moisture can weaken paint and wallpaper, leading to peeling and deterioration.Decreased Visibility: Condensation can impair visibility through windows, interfering with the aesthetics of a space.Handling and Preventing Window Condensation

Frequently Asked Questions About Window Condensation
Q1: Is condensation on windows an indication of a serious problem?A: Not always. Condensation can occur for various reasons, however persistent moisture can result in bigger issues like mold, so it's crucial to handle it efficiently. Q2: How can I inform if my windows are the cause of indoor humidity?A: If
condensation forms primarily on your windows and no other surface areas, it's
often a sign that your windows are significantly chillier than the air inside your home. Q3: Will opening windows in winter help minimize condensation?A: Yes, opening windows sometimes can assist permit wet air to leave, reducing the overall humidity levels in the home.
